HS-CNN: a CNN with hybrid convolution scale for EEG motor imagery classification.

TL;DR: This work has proposed a hybrid-scale CNN architecture with a data augmentation method for EEG motor imagery classification that effectively addressed the issues of existing CNN-based EEGMotor imagery classification methods and improved the classification accuracy.

TSE-CNN: A Two-Stage End-to-End CNN for Human Activity Recognition

TL;DR: A new human activity recognition method with two-stage end-to-end convolutional neural network and a data augmentation method that achieves significantly improved recognition accuracy and reduced computational complexity.

Energy-Efficient Intelligent ECG Monitoring for Wearable Devices

TL;DR: This work has proposed an energy-efficient wearable intelligent ECG monitor scheme with two-stage end-to-end neural network and diagnosis-based adaptive compression that significantly reduces the power consumption in ECG diagnosis and transmission while maintaining high accuracy.

An Energy-Efficient Reconfigurable AI-Based Object Detection and Tracking Processor Supporting Online Object Learning

TL;DR: Compared with several state-of-the-art designs, the proposed design achieves better energy efficiency (2.13 mJ/frame), while supporting flexible object detection and tracking tasks with online object learning.
